Ray J is Brandy’s little brother, and he once had sex with Kim Kardashian and filmed it. You may remember that sex tape, which was filmed in 2003 and released in 2007, for being definitive proof that Ray J once had sex with Kim Kardashian. In case you had forgotten that Ray J and Kim Kardashian have had sex, Ray J is releasing a new single to iTunes next week titled “I Hit it First.” It’s a not-so-sly shot at Kanye West, who is expecting a baby girl with Kardashian later this year. Ray J really wants you to remember that he once had sex with Kim Kardashian, even before Kanye West. Applaud this man!

Of course, the sad irony for Ray J is that the sex tape only launched one career. Kardashian has gone on to build a powerhouse brand — last year Forbes ranked her at No. 7 on their “Celebrity 100” list. She earned an estimated $18 million in 2012 off of her various reality shows, endorsements and own retail products. Ray J, meanwhile, did not land anywhere on Forbes’ “Celebrity 100” list.
